Zippia's data science team found the following key facts about high school biology teachers after extensive research and analysis:
- There are over 169,526 high school biology teachers currently employed in the United States.
- 65.6% of all high school biology teachers are women, while 34.4% are men.
- The average high school biology teacher age is 43 years old.
- The most common ethnicity of high school biology teachers is White (72.5%), followed by Hispanic or Latino (11.6%), Black or African American (7.9%) and Unknown (4.0%).
- In 2022, women earned 95% of what men earned.
- 12% of all high school biology teachers are LGBT.
- High school biology teachers are 90% more likely to work at education companies in comparison to private companies.

High school biology teacher gender ratio over time
High school biology teacher gender ratio by year
| Year |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 33.36% | 66.64% |
| 2011 | 33.61% | 66.39% |
| 2012 | 34.34% | 65.66% |
| 2013 | 33.50% | 66.50% |
| 2014 | 33.46% | 66.54% |
| 2015 | 33.34% | 66.66% |
| 2016 | 33.58% | 66.42% |
| 2017 | 33.87% | 66.13% |
| 2018 | 33.22% | 66.78% |
| 2019 | 34.34% | 65.66% |
| 2020 | 34.91% | 65.09% |
| 2021 | 34.43% | 65.57% |

High school biology teacher race and ethnicity over time
See how high school biology teacher racial and ethnic diversity trended since 2010 according to the United States Census Bureau data.
High school biology teacher race and ethnicity by year
| Year | White | Black or African American | Asian | Hispanic or Latino |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 76.68% | 8.74% | 2.70% | 9.78% |
| 2011 | 76.35% | 8.79% | 2.89% | 9.78% |
| 2012 | 75.98% | 8.53% | 2.96% | 10.24% |
| 2013 | 76.34% | 8.40% | 2.97% | 10.25% |
| 2014 | 75.51% | 9.00% | 3.00% | 10.52% |
| 2015 | 75.11% | 8.50% | 3.55% | 10.49% |
| 2016 | 75.38% | 8.21% | 2.92% | 11.09% |
| 2017 | 76.18% | 7.50% | 3.08% | 10.88% |
| 2018 | 75.14% | 7.73% | 3.73% | 11.00% |
| 2019 | 76.44% | 7.53% | 3.30% | 10.60% |
| 2020 | 73.99% | 7.30% | 3.32% | 10.96% |
| 2021 | 72.50% | 7.93% | 3.57% | 11.57% |

High school biology teacher unemployment rate over time
High school biology teacher unemployment rate by year
| Year | High school biology teacher unemployment rate |
|---|---|
| 2010 | 2.75% |
| 2011 | 2.67% |
| 2012 | 2.79% |
| 2013 | 2.31% |
| 2014 | 2.01% |
| 2015 | 1.53% |
| 2016 | 1.51% |
| 2017 | 1.10% |
| 2018 | 1.28% |
| 2019 | 1.36% |
| 2020 | 1.67% |
| 2021 | 1.81% |
